#323b5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#323b5c is composed of 19.6% red, 23.1%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 27.8%. #323b5c color hex could be obtained by blending #6476b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#323b5c color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#323b5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#323b5c has RGB values of R:50, G:59,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3291996.

Shades and Tints of #323b5c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#323b5c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42444c is the less saturated color, while #011f8d is the most saturated one.
